What will replace former Galaba cinema? - PHOTOS
23 January 2013 [14:27] -
TODAY.AZ
A grand office building will replace the Galaba cinema located in the Yasamal district of Baku. The construction was already launched.
The Yasamal district executive power reported that the building is constructed by a private firm. The work is expected to be completed next year.
